Standard Facts
We off er various corrosion and/or temperature resistant roller chain solutions to suit the unique demands of pretty much any application. These range from plated or coated carbon steels to a variety of diff erent stainless steel forms that may be selected based mostly on the preferred mixture of wear resistance, power, corrosion resistance and resistance to extremes in operating temperatures.
Nickel Plating
Appropriate for mild corrosive disorders this kind of as outside services. Normally made use of for decorative purposes. Chain parts are plated prior to assembly for uniform coverage of internal components.
Sort 304 Stainless
Our normal stainless steel product or service off ers superb resistance to corrosion and operates successfully more than a broad array of temperatures. This material is slightly magnetic as a result of work hardening in the elements during the manufacturing processes.
Form 316 Stainless
This materials possess better corrosion and temperature resistance in contrast with Type 304SS. It can be typically utilized in the food processing sector on account of its resistance to worry corrosion cracking during the presence of chlorides this kind of as are observed in liquid smoke. The magnetic permeability of this material is really minimal and is generally thought of nonmagnetic nevertheless it can be not thought of to be prspark oof.
600 Series Stainless
Pins, bushings and rollers are produced from 17-4PH stainless steels which could be hardened for improved resistance to dress in elongation. The corrosion resistance of this chain is much like
Type 304SS. The operating temperature array of this materials even so is not really as good as Form 304SS.
Mega Chain:
A higher power 304 stainless steel chain. Out there in two versions which use diff erent mechanical confi gurations to acquire extra strength. Each versions off er higher operating loads as a result of a greater pin/bushing bearing location and also a unique labyrinth variety seal that helps avoid the penetration of abrasive foreign products to your internal wearing components.
